在现代计算机操作中,Linux因其强大的功能和灵活性而被广泛使用。无论是服务器管理、软件开发还是日常任务,掌握Linux命令都是非常重要的技能。本文将介绍在Linux系统中如何显示所有文件及其内容的命令,帮助读者更好地利用这种强大的工具。
首先我们来看看如何显示当前目录下的所有文件。在Linux中,我们通常使用命令行界面来与系统交互。要显示当前目录中的所有文件,可以使用以下命令:
ls
这个命令将列出当前目录下的所有文件和文件夹。如果你想要列出更多信息,比如文件的详细信息和隐藏文件,可以使用:
ls -la
其中`-l`代表以长格式显示,`-a`则表示包括以点(.)开头的隐藏文件。运行这个命令后,你将看到文件的权限、所有者、大小、修改时间等信息,非常适合文件管理和查看。
接下来如果你想查看某个特定文件的内容,Linux提供了几个非常实用的命令。其中最常用的命令是`cat`,它可以用来连接文件并查看内容。使用方法如下:
cat 文件名
例如如果你有一个名为`example.txt`的文本文件,可以输入:
cat example.txt
这将会在终端中显示`example.txt`文件的所有内容。如果文件内容较多,可能会超出一个屏幕的显示,这时可以使用`less`命令来便捷地查看文件内容。使用方式为:
less 文件名
在`less`命令中,你可以使用向上和向下箭头键进行滚动,也可以输入`/`后跟要查找的字符串来搜索内容,按`q`则可以退出。
除了`cat`和`less`外,还有其他一些命令可以查看文件内容。例如`more`命令也可以逐屏显示文件内容,使用方法类似于`less`:
more 文件名
更高级的文本查看工具是`head`和`tail`,它们分别用于查看文件的开头和结尾部分。下面是它们的使用方法:
head 文件名
tail 文件名
默认情况下`head`和`tail`命令显示的是文件的前10行或后10行内容。如果你只想查看特定数量的行,可以使用`-n`选项,例如查看前20行:
head -n 20 文件名
tail -n 20 文件名
对于编程人员和系统管理员来说能够灵活运用这些命令是日常工作中的基本需求。了解这些命令不仅可以帮助你高效地管理文件系统,还能让你在排错和查看日志文件时事半功倍。
总结来说Linux在日常文件管理和查看内容方面提供了丰富的命令支持。通过使用`ls`命令来查看文件列表,以及结合`cat`、`less`、`more`、`head`和`tail`等命令查看文件内容,用户可以高效地进行文件管理。掌握这些基本命令,将大大提升你的工作效率,也能让你在Linux的世界中游刃有余。
希望这篇文章能帮助你更好地理解Linux的文件管理命令,提升你的使用技巧。无论你是初学者还是经验丰富的用户,熟悉这些命令都是使用Linux的基础和关键。